Chapter Three: Eternal Longing (Part IV)

The gaze of the Sun-Wielding Envoy, who was dressed in green clothing, remained just like a dead man's, without half a bit of human emotion.

 

His gaze was not cold at all, yet it could make a person shudder without being cold.

 

"Good skill!"

 

Like a streak of a startled swan, his circular blade was already out of its scabbard.

 

──The "Long Rainbow Piercing the Sun" of the Cold Water Palace.

 

A piece of white silk handkerchief lightly wiped across the blade edge, and was immediately tossed onto the ground.

 

"My blade has always never been wiped unless it sees blood. Today, I make an exception for your excellency."

 

"To be able to exchange moves with your excellency makes my trip to the Central Plains not in vain. For 'Long Rainbow Piercing the Sun' to face the 'Zhanlu' in your excellency's hand also does not waste the lifelong heroic fame of this weapon."

 

He had been standing to the side all along, and had actually already recognized the long sword in Zhan Rifei's hand.

 

"I kill people, and have always used only one move. I would like to see whether your excellency can take three moves from me."

 

He grinned savagely.

 

"Only because under my Cold Water Blade Technique, no one can use tricks."

 

Along with the words landing on the ground, his move was already launched!

 

The blade momentum appeared extremely slow.

 

The Sun-Wielding Envoy held the blade with both hands simultaneously, holding it high toward heaven, just like a sudden clap of thunder in a dry sky. Person and blade united as one, the momentum fierce and sharp, extraordinarily majestic and vigorous. A wave of strangling force, swirling, responding to the blade momentum, instantly filled heaven and earth.

 

Zhan Rifei's face actually changed somewhat. The Sun-Wielding Envoy's blade momentum looked extremely slow, but turned out to be three moves launched together!

 

Under the surging blade momentum, it nevertheless sealed heaven and closed earth; the three blades were like rising and falling billows, vast and boundless, making it so a person had nowhere to avoid. Zhan Rifei especially could not retreat.

 

Behind him, was precisely that thin and weak boy.

 

Facing such a blade momentum, how was he to receive the move?

 

With a "chi" sound, the lapel of the boy standing behind Zhan Rifei had already split. The powerful blade wind had already shocked him so he fell backward, pressing down so he could not catch his breath. His young and small body was just like a solitary boat about to capsize in this violent storm.

 

The icy sharp edge seemed to have already pierced into his skin, making him break out in goosebumps. The Sun-Wielding Envoy's sharp internal energy made his eyes as if afflicted by a blight, unable to open again!

 

Within the haziness, he only vaguely saw a streak of ice-colored brilliance fly up from Zhan Rifei's hand.

 

The boy had never thought before that there would actually be a brilliance that assumed an ice color in this world, and that this brilliance would actually be so magnificent.

 

Blade and sword finally intersected!

 

That was a clear and resonant sound like a world of ice and snow.

 

Yet this sound was also so suppressed.

 

Being shocked by this sound that was not loud or resonant, the boy actually spat out a mouthful of fresh blood directly. His chest was as if struck by a large hammer, and with a roll of his two eyes, he actually fainted away.

 

At the moment he lost consciousness, there was a hand that had already gripped his arm.


For a time, he only felt that that hand possessed an unspeakable coldness.
